时间:2025-02-03 来源:网络 人气:
亲爱的安卓6系统用户们,你是否曾好奇过,那些神秘的证书都藏在手机的哪个角落里呢?别急,今天就来带你一探究竟,揭开安卓6系统证书存放位置的神秘面纱!
你知道吗,安卓6系统中的证书就像是一群小精灵,它们藏匿在手机的系统深处,等待着被召唤。那么,它们究竟藏在哪里呢?别着急,让我来给你指路。
一、证书的“家”——/system/etc/security/cacerts
首先,我们要找到证书的“家”——那就是著名的 `/system/etc/security/cacerts` 目录。这个目录就像是一个存放证书的宝库,里面存放着各种系统证书,包括但不限于CA证书、设备制造商证书等。
在 `/system/etc/security/cacerts` 目录中,你会看到许多以 `.0`、`.1`、`.2` 等结尾的文件。这些文件就是证书,而它们的文件名就像是一张张身份证,记录着证书的详细信息。
那么,这些文件名有什么特殊之处呢?其实,它们遵循着一定的规则。一般来说,文件名由证书的哈希值和编号组成。例如,一个名为 `0dd2455e.0` 的文件,它的哈希值就是 `0dd2455e`,而编号则是 `0`。
你可能好奇,这些证书的原始格式是什么呢?其实,它们大多以 `.cer` 或 `.pem` 格式存在。在安卓6系统中,证书通常以 `.cer` 格式存储,但有时也会以 `.pem` 格式出现。
如果你需要将证书从 `.cer` 格式转换为 `.pem` 格式,或者进行其他格式转换,可以使用一些工具,如 OpenSSL。以下是一个简单的转换示例:
```bash
openssl x509 -inform DER -outform PEM -in 证书文件.cer -out 证书文件.pem
找到了证书的存放位置,了解了证书的格式,那么如何将证书导入到安卓6系统中呢?以下是一些常见的导入方法:
1. 通过设置导入:打开手机的“设置”菜单,找到“安全”或“隐私”选项,然后选择“证书管理”或“安全证书”。在这里,你可以导入证书。
2. 通过第三方应用导入:有些第三方应用也提供了证书导入功能,你可以尝试使用这些应用来导入证书。
3. 通过ADB命令导入:如果你熟悉ADB(Android Debug Bridge),可以使用ADB命令来导入证书。
导入证书后,你还需要设置信任。在“设置”菜单中,找到“安全”或“隐私”选项,然后选择“信任管理”或“安全证书”。在这里,你可以选择信任证书。
通过这篇文章,相信你已经对安卓6系统证书存放位置有了更深入的了解。现在,你就像拥有一张藏宝图,可以轻松找到那些神秘的证书了。不过,别忘了,证书的导入和信任设置都需要谨慎操作,以免造成不必要的麻烦。
亲爱的安卓6系统用户们,希望这篇文章能帮助你更好地管理证书,让你的手机更加安全、稳定。如果你还有其他疑问,欢迎在评论区留言,我们一起探讨!